Integrated Multi-Omics and Interactome Analysis of CDK8 Inhibition Reveals Erythroid Differentiation Programs and BET Synergy in AML Stem-like Cells
2026-03-26
Abstract excerpt
<title>Abstract</title> <p>Background. Acute myeloid leukemia (AML) remains among the most therapeutically challenging hematologic malignancies, driven largely by the self-renewal capacity, quiescence, and therapy resistance of leukemic stem cells (LSCs).
